Hey Barbara S we were at Hotel Pasquale in May! Wonder if I saw you at breakfast . The noise from the trains is significant, but nothing keeps me awake so I didn't care.

The walk from Monterosso to Vernazza, the next town is fabulous but a killer. The 1st 30 mins or so is all uphill and thus, all steps. You may be better to catch a ferry to another town and start your walk at an easier stage.
